Ban The Sale Of Ring-Style Frisbees By Retailers

Closed 668 signatures

What the petition asks

Ring-Style Frisbees are harming our marine wildlife. The recent entanglement of WINGS the seal in Cornwall. These need to be stopped being sold by retailers. They are increasingly becoming serious issue across the country for seals that become entangled in them can lead to a prolonged painful death.
Ring-Style Frisbees, if thrown into the sea, can get embedded into seals necks and cause, I should imagine, a lot of pain or death.

Seals are inquisitive mammals and if they find a ring floating on the surface of the sea or ocean may become entangled. If not rescued and the ring removed it could ultimately lead to a prolonged and painful death. These ringed frisbees need to be stopped being sold by retailers and purchased by customers who use and lose them in the sea.
